Abstract

A multiple device implemented project management system which includes a management core implemented on a central computer system. Data on a database of the central computer system is accessible to peripheral multiple devices in communication with the central computer system. Data entered from the peripheral devices is processed for assessing completion of skill acquisition, physical attendance, risk assessment and resource allocation modules. The management system issues employee competency certificates based on completion of the skill acquisition modules retained on said database. The training modules include modules specific to acquisition of skills associated with related technical areas of a project, resource arid equipment allocation and appropriate rating of risk associated therewith.

PROJECT MANAGEMENT SYSTEM
TECHNICAL FIELD
[0001] The present invention relates to the management of complex projects and employees and more particularly, to a multiple device implemented system, providing management to enable the timely compliance with health and safety regulations, as well as quality control relating to tasks, skills and risks weighting and assessment.
BACKGROUND
[0002] Service industries often face major organizational and operational complexities. This is particularly true in areas of the building industry for example, in which management is required of different levels and skills of personnel, deployment of equipment and the purchase and use of consumables to list but a few examples .
[0003] Employers often find it difficult to fill vacancies for an occupation, or to retain workers for a sufficient time to develop competencies with specific skills. Ensuring quality control requires the development of specific skills unique to a particular individual and auditing of these skills to ensure integrity is maintained in the skills being developed. Typically, training may take place on an ad hoc basis with little facility for structured record keeping of progress,- assessment of
competency and risks or the possibility of reward based on standardised criteria.
[0004] It is typical also in these and related industries, that work is conducted at dispersed work sites, often by different groups of specifically skilled workers, using a variety of equipment and materials with varying levels of competency and risk. [0005] In some jurisdictions at least, it is mandatory that employers provide records of and monitor all activities in the work place. These activities generally fall into various
categories, and may include, use of chemicals, materials, tools and equipment and ensuring on-site attendance to match those records .
[0006] As well, attitudes and behaviour are important to effective operation and in addition to any mandatory requirements above, and represent some of the aspects that must be monitored and developed by employees and independent contractors.
[0007] Another problem in many organizations is that many of the skills required are not available through existing educational facilities. Rather the development of many of the skills can only be acquired through long-term repetitive practical exposure and of tasks and by means of tailored training modules.
[0008] To continue with the example of the building industry, a multitude of very varied tasks are called upon in modern building and civil engineering projects. Many tasks require personnel with very particular skills, expertise and specialised training in the use of equipment and materials and related safety aspects. Keeping track of which employees have a particular skill, training or are certified in a particular discipline can become a major
organizational problem, even for companies with a relatively small number of employees and / or independent contractors.
[0009] The task of efficiently organising, supplying and monitoring the operations in these environments becomes extremely complex and can easily lead to waste of labour, resources and materials. It is essential for efficient operation that all stages of projects be closely monitored with reports flowing back to a central management hub as frequently and as early as possible. Paper-based time sheets, diaries, written reports, working drawings, specifications etc. are cumbersome and difficult to manage. Reports and other documents associated with a project may be lost or take time to reach the hub from remote locations, and when received need to be entered laboriously into some form of centralized record system.
[0010] It is an object of the present invention to address or at least ameliorate some of the above disadvantages.

DESCRIPTION OF EMBODIMENTS
[0066] The present invention provides for. a multiple devices implemented project management system. The system is an html implemented interactive system accessible over the Internet to authorized personnel through username and password log-on. Remote access to the system is provided to management, supervisor and worker levels through any internet enabled communication device such as laptops, tablets and smart phones for example.
[0067] The system includes a management core, divided into Projects, Employees, Independent Contractors, Training and
Assessment and Reports modules. The management core is implemented on a central computer database maintained by a management organization or the employing company. Data in the database is made accessible to peripheral multiple remote devices authorized to communicate with and access the database for both extraction and addition of data.
Projects
[0068] The management core as shown in figures 1 and 2 of the system includes separate lists of current projects (10) and pending projects (12) as shown in figures 1 and 2 respectively. Each list of current and pending projects includes data modules
(14) associated with the management of that project. As shown in figure 1, the entry for each current project (10) includes a string of icons representing a "number of project parameters.
[0069] With reference to figure 3, a first icon (16) provides access to Project Details (18. These may include a project identifying name and or number, the name of the client and contact details, project location as well as start date and end date.
[0070] The second icon (20) brings up a Project Check Sheet (22) shown in figure 4 which provides a detailed project task listing (24), the date (26) the Check Sheet was created, who created it and also provides a percentage progress value (28). Also provided is access to a template (30) for the creation of a new Check Sheet.
[0071] The third icon (32) in the series provides access to Files or documents (34) as shown in figure XX associated with the project. These files include third party provided data on products and equipment which are expected to be used o.n the project.
Typically they may be Adobe® .pdf files (36) provided as html links to data sheets on the web site of the third party product provider, such as the product data sheet (38) shown in figures 6 and 7. Various options are built into the files displayed including the ability to add details of experience with the product which can be saved for future reference.
[0072] A fourth icon (40) (still with reference to figure 1), provides a record (42) of emails sent and received related to a project, as shown for example in figure 8. These may included emails between the company and .its client, but will also provide a trail of emails to and from employees on site at the project location. Any email in the list can be selected and the email content reviewed, or forwarded to other recipients for example.
[0073] A further fifth icon (44) gives access to a diary of activities associated with the project. The diary consists of a list of dates (46) as shown in figure 9 for each day employees or contractors were active on the project. Each of the dates can be expanded, ' as shown in the example of figure 10, to show details of the employees or contractors active on the project on that day. Activities of each of the employees can be accessed to see the times spent and brief descriptions of the particular jobs or activities worked on. Any difficulties encountered, experience gained or any other comments which may assist in assessing progress and conduct of a particular task may be entered here by a job supervisor.
[0074] A sixth icon (48) provides access to a file of any photographs which may relate to the project and which may provide a record of progress, difficulties encountered as well as
providing possible material for training employees, contractors or planning future projects.
[0075] A following seventh icon (50) brings up a listing of time sheets as shown in figure 11 for each week of the year collated from daily time sheets submitted by employees engaged on the project. Each weekly record can be expanded to display daily time sheets (52) for employees or contractors working in that week as shown in figure 12.
[0076] The eighth icon (54) for a project accesses Inspection Test Plan ("ITP") records (56) for the project as shown in figure 13.- An edit function (58) leads to a record as shown in figure 14 of any testing results (60) associated with a project.
[0077] A final icon (62) provides access to daily work dockets which provide summaries prepared by task supervisors of personnel employed, eguipment use and other cost aspects incurred.
[0078] As well as the icons which provide very detailed
information on all aspects of a particular project, a segmented and colour coded time line (.66) allows rapid inspection of the progress and completion of major stages. These stages include, completion of documentation before actual commencement of the project, IPTs, material purchase orders, allocation of staff, job completion, as well as invoicing and payment received. Colour coding indicates the completion of each stage.
Employees
[0079] The employee section of the management system of the invention allows for the management and display of time sheets for individual employees and independent contractors and physical location of same at all relevant times as data is recorded. As shown in figure 15, time sheets may be accessed by entry of employee or contractor name, physical location, equipment and materials used and a date of interest. Details, such as times worked, physical location, the project worked on and the
particular activities engaged in, may be accessed from this time sheet record.
[0080] Time sheets in the first instance are completed by employees or contractors and uploaded to the database by means of any of the remote devices able and authorized to communicate with the central computer. Time sheets must be approved by a supervisor in charge of the project or particular work on the day in
question. As shown in figure 16, time sheets submitted by
employees or contractors but not yet checked and approved by a supervisor are listed for action.
Training & Assessment
[0081] An important function of the database includes
assessment of accumulating skill acquisition modules completed by employees of the company or contractors and available for display and completion on-line in a Training and Assessment matrix (70) as shown in figure 17. The system generates certificates, based on points accrued for completion of the skill training modules retained on the database, which are specific to acquisition of skills associated with personal development as well as related technical areas of a project. The index (70) of the training modules offered is searchable by management to ascertain which of the organization's employees or contractors have completed a particular module.
[0082] The skill training modules of the system are provided as on-line training manuals which may be accessed by employees, and contractors on any of the remote communication devices. Modules may include various aspects of personal development. Examples may include development of supervisory skills in assessing staff for appropriate allocation to tasks, recognizing people's potential, making difficult decisions and how to take appropriate
disciplinary action.
[0083] Other modules provide information and training in the proper and safe use of equipment, tools and materials. Modules, where appropriate, are multilayered with internet links providing access to third party data sheets (such as shown in figure 7 for example) on equipment and materials. Similarly, training modules may include links to Internet hosted demonstration videos.
[0084] Training modules include questionnaires for completion by employees on-line with successful completions recorded in the database. Search facilities then allow management to quickly identify those personnel who have acquired a particular skill and are competent to undertake a particular task. [0085] A staff training matrix (72) shown in figure 18 is included in the database and displays a listing of all employees with indications of which modules have been completed and the date completed. The database further provides a listing for individual employees and contractors as shown in figure 19 of those training modules still to be completed by that employee or contractor. The employee or contractor can expand any of those listed to access the particular training and instruction elements for the selected module as shown in figure 20.
[0086] A training matrix for efficiency ratings is generated by the system. This matrix (74) shown in figure 21 allows management to review the achieved proficiencies of individual employees or contractors and may form the basis for an incentive points system for awarding above average performance for example.
Reports
[0087] . A further module of the management system of the invention deals with reports. As shown in figure 22, Employee Worksheet Summaries (76) are accessible by week. Selection of a particular week (for example the week 25/04/2011-01/05/2011) displays a listing of the projects worked on during that week as shown in figure 23.
[0088] A further display shown in figure 24 may be accessed from the display of figure 23, providing access to the tasks and associated details of a particular employee or contractor on a particular day of the week. Thus for example, the project worked on, the activities undertaken and the times spent can be
ascertained for employee Wilmot on the day of Wednesday
27/04/2011. In Use
[0089] In use, with reference to figure 26, the users 102 of the system 100 at various remote locations may access the central computer and database 110 either directly from remote computers 112 via the internet 114, or from a variety of hand-held devices 116 via a distributed mobile phone network 118. By these means users can both download and upload data relevant to a project or to any one of the training modules retained on the database 120. Once a training module has been completed, the system 100 may issue a certificate 122 indicating the skill and knowledge acquired to the remote user 102.
[0090] The management system of the invention thus provides a comprehensive system for the management of all aspects of
projects, employee training, time management, risks assessment and asset and equipment allocation. By implementing the system on a centralized computer with access to the system by means of remote communication devices, employees, contractors and supervising staff for multiple projects in disparate locations can be managed efficiently.
[0091] The particular facility of employee or contractor training and tracking of acquired skill modules, provides for high staff morale and affords management the ability to efficiently allocate appropriate personnel to a given project task.
[0092] The links provided within the system database to third party equipment, material specification and instruction manuals, as well as providing material for training, allows employees "on the job" to access online accurate information on safety and proper usage as well as efficient use of that equipment and material and its allocation.
[0093] The links provided within the system database thus provides a comprehensive system for the management of all aspects of risks assessment, weighting, allocation of and use of equipment, asset and resources, measuring the degree of non¬ conformance to industry standards and likelihood of defects and rate of deterioration and the rating of risks arising from the weighting and measurements so made. By implementing the system on a centralized computer with access to the system by means of remote communication devices, employees, contractors and
supervising staff, equipment and assets allocated in multiple projects in disparate locations can be managed, rated and rewarded efficiently.
